What is Leverage in Crypto Trading?
Leverage allows traders to control a larger position than they could with their capital alone. Think of it like taking out a loan to invest in a bigger asset. However, if the market turns, the potential for loss also increases dramatically.
Benefits and Risks of HIBT Leverage
- Potential for Higher Returns: With leverage, even a small price movement can lead to significant profits.
- Increased Exposure: Traders can gain exposure to more assets without needing more capital upfront.
- Market Volatility: The crypto market’s inherent volatility means that these profits can quickly turn into losses.
- Margin Calls: If the market moves against a trader’s position, they may receive a margin call requiring them to deposit more funds.
Risk Management Strategies for HIBT Crypto
Managing risk is essential when leveraging HIBT crypto. Here are some proven strategies:

- Position Sizing: Limit the amount of capital used to trade HIBT to a manageable percentage of your total portfolio.
- Stop-Loss Orders: Setting stop-loss orders can minimize losses if the market moves against you. Like a safety net, these orders can prevent catastrophic losses.
- Diversification: Spread your investments across various assets to reduce risk.
